Act quickly

Don’t ignore dead pet odours

The longer a carcass remains, the stronger the odour becomes and the higher the risk of health issues and pest infestations.

  • Strong, persistent odours coming from walls, ceilings, or under floors
  • Increased fly activity around your property
  • Unusual stains or damp patches on ceilings or walls
  • Scratching or scurrying sounds in roof spaces or wall cavities

Dead pets in hidden areas can create serious health risks and unpleasant living conditions. The odour from decomposing animals attracts flies and other pests, which can spread bacteria throughout your home or business. In Chatswood West’s older properties, wall cavities and roof spaces provide ideal conditions for carcasses to go unnoticed until the problem becomes severe.

How it works

Our dead pet removal process

We follow a thorough, discreet process to locate, remove, and sanitise affected areas while minimising disruption to your property.

  1. 1

    Initial assessment

    We discuss the situation over the phone to understand the location and urgency. For hidden carcasses, we may ask about unusual smells, flies, or signs of animal activity.

  2. 2

    Safe access

    Our technicians use appropriate equipment to access difficult areas like roof voids, wall cavities, or under structures without damaging your property.

  3. 3

    Carcass removal

    We carefully extract the deceased animal, ensuring no traces remain. All materials are bagged and disposed of according to local regulations.

  4. 4

    Sanitisation

    We treat the area with professional-grade disinfectants to eliminate odours and bacteria. This step prevents further pest attraction and health risks.

  5. 5

    Final check

    We verify the area is clean and odour-free before leaving. Our team provides a summary of what was done and any recommendations for prevention.
